AS hot and dry weather hits several areas in the country, Ata Abdul Razak, 8, cools himself down by playing in a river in Lenggong, Perak. He whips his wet hair, splashing water droplets around him. 

Ata is only one of the many students who are spending the finals days of the end-of-term school holidays with their family members, enjoying recreational outdoor activities.

Lenggong, situated around 100km from Ipoh, Perak, is a beloved destination for Malaysians, especially outdoor enthusiasts. – February 16, 2024
